This mansion was the residence of Governor Weatherby Swann, his daughter Elizabeth Swann and their staff, in Port Royal following their crossing from England. It was located in the fashionable St. Paul's district.[1]

The grand mansion was situated far from the squalour of Port Royal's docks and slums. It came under siege by the crew of the Black Pearl during the raid on Port Royal, during which Elizabeth was kidnapped. The mansion was struck by cannonfire, and many of its valuables plundered by the pirates. By the time Weatherby returned to his wrecked home, Elizabeth was already sailing from the port as Hector Barbossa's captive.[1]
